Tornado watch called after funnel cloud spotted near Choiceland

Environment Canada has issued a tornado watch for the area around Melfort, Tisdale, Nipawin and Carrot River.

At around 10 a.m. Friday, a funnel cloud was spotted five kilometres north of Choiceland it was headed southeast at 20 kilometres per hour.

"Conditions are favourable for the development of funnel clouds or weak tornadoes," according to the notification on Environment Canada's website.
